Typical Costs for Loft Conversion Types in Newham E13, E15, E16

Smart budgeting matters for loft projects in East London. Costs in 2026 for Newham reflect London-wide trends, shaped by roof type, finishes, structural work and location factors. Here are current realistic ranges from recent similar projects:

  • Velux loft conversion (rooflights for light, low external impact): £45,000 to £55,000. Great for budget-friendly extra bedrooms.
  • Dormer loft conversion (rear or side extension for headroom): £50,000 to £70,000. Favoured for spacious, practical rooms.
  • L-shaped dormer loft conversion (wrap-around for max area): £55,000 to £75,000. Versatile for multiple rooms, possibly with terrace access.
  • Hip-to-gable loft conversion (sloping to vertical gable): £60,000 to £80,000. Ideal for semis or end-terraces needing more volume.
  • Mansard loft conversion (steep rear for big gains): £65,000 to £90,000+. Suited to period styles wanting substantial extra space.
  • L-shaped mansard: £70,000 to £100,000+. Combines elements for generous, multi-purpose layouts.

Prices cover essentials like stairs, insulation and basic finishes. Add-ons (premium materials, plumbing, joinery) increase totals. Common Property Styles in Newham and Suitable Loft Conversion Options

Newham features a rich array of homes that respond well to careful loft conversions. Victorian and Edwardian terraces prevail in many streets across Plaistow (E13), parts of Stratford (E15) and older pockets near Canning Town, boasting high ceilings, brick detailing and pitched roofs perfect for Velux or dormer additions that maintain heritage appeal.

Post-war semis and some detached properties appear in regenerating zones, with solid builds suited to hip-to-gable work for enhanced headroom. We customise each conversion to harmonise, matching bricks, tiles and windows for seamless street presence.

Planning Regulations, Certificate of Lawfulness and Architectural Support  Handled by Absolute Lofts

Rules can seem complex, but most Newham loft conversions qualify under permitted development: up to 40 cubic metres on terraces or 50 on detached, within height and setback rules, often without full planning. Dormers or mansards may need approval; we assess early.

We secure Certificates of Lawfulness routinely, confirming compliance for future peace of mind and sales. Our architects create accurate drawings, manage submissions and oversee Building Regulations covering safety, insulation, fire and electrics.
